Overview
Vice City International Airport (IATA: VCI) is the primary international airport serving Vice-Dale County and Leonidathat is set to appear in Grand Theft Auto VI. The airport is located in an unincorporated area of Vice-Dale County within the mainland of Vice Citysituated close to the city center. It is a large facility with direct access to highways and nearby hotels, and it features its own automated transit system.

Legacy
In the 3D Universe version of Vice City (an earlier entry in the series and Vice City Stories), the city's airport was known as Escobar International Airport. Whether Vice City International Airport shares any continuity with its predecessor remains unclear, as GTA VI takes place in the HD Universe, which is separate from the 3D Universe timeline. The renaming from "Escobar" to "Vice City" International mirrors how real-world airports occasionally rebrand to reflect their metropolitan area rather than a historical figure.
